Leveraging Information Goo

Making the Most of Data "To leverage unstructured data -- i.e., information that does not or cannot reside in relational databases -- technology must impose organization where none exists. Analogous to tables and schemas in relational databases, taxonomies and metadata organize and categorize the unstructured world."

"As a result, the data discovery and classification process must be easy enough to happen on a constant basis. Moreover, it must occur without an army of library scientists -- small teams of experts who are actually using the information themselves should be able to create the taxonomies, and define whether the topics and categorization schema are meaningful and important."
